Croque Señora Recipe
Cubano sandwich (house porchetta, honey ham, Swiss cheese, dill pickles, yellow mustard, house Cuban bun, pressed), fried local free run egg, charred poblano cream sauce, crispy potatoes

Method
Preparing the Charred Poblano Cream Sauce
Char the Poblano
Roast the poblano pepper over an open flame until charred. Place it in a bowl, cover with plastic wrap, and let it steam for 10 minutes. Peel and chop.
Make the Sauce
In a saucepan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ant. Add heavy cream, charred poblano, salt, and pepper, and simmer for 5 minutes until thickened.
Cooking the Potatoes
Fry the Potatoes
In a frying pan, heat oil over medium heat. Add the potatoes and fry until crispy, about 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Assembling the Sandwich
Press the Sandwich
Heat a panini press or skillet over medium heat. Place the sandwich in and press down until the cheese is melted and the bread is golden brown, about 5 minutes.
